Oven Broiled Swordfish
2 (8 oz.) swordfish
1/4 cup sour cream
1/4 cup mayonnaise
1 1/2 tsp. lemon and pepper seasoning salt
Rinse fish and pat dry. Place steaks on a cookie sheet lined with aluminum foil. Combine sour cream and mayonnaise, spread over fish. Sprinkle seasoning over, broil in middle of the oven until golden brown. Check for doneness (fish should flake with fork). If necessary, bake a few more minutes at 350. Serves 2.
BASIC FORMULA FOR SHARK, SWORDFISH, AND HALIBUT
If you like beef steak, you will love these dense fish. Preheat broiler to 400 . Adjust rack 3" from heat. Brush fish with good oil (butter will burn). Cook 6-7 minutes each side, brushing with oil after turning. Add garlic, lemon, or fresh cracked pepper if you like.
